- Hiring hub
- Submit vacancy
- Career advice
- CV information
- Employment advice
- Interview advice
- Career advice from our recruitment specialists
- About us
Systems Engineering Manager
A Systems Engineering Manager is required to join our client based in Glasgow on a contractor basis. This will be to work on the Hunter Class Frigate and Globat Combat Ship contracts.
The purpose of this role is to provide strategic leadership and direction to the deployment of Model Based Systems Engineering and systems safety across Marine Systems.
The role is charged with leading a transformation to Marine Systems' approach to design analysis through the deployment of novel systems engineering design techniques to the complex warship environment.
It will be responsible for developing and delivering the Marine Systems integrated functional model as well as leading analysis of the design from an integration and safety perspective.
Major Tasks and Activities:
- Provide strategic leadership of the Systems Engineering, modelling and system safety team
- Lead the continued transformation of Marine Engineering and the adoption of systems engineering practices.
- Lead the roll-out of model based systems engineering (MBSE) across the wider Marine Systems domain; establish the policies, processes and capability requirements for MBSE.
- Lead the development of the Marine Systems integrated functional model (structural, functional and control) using SysML.
- Ensure that operability considerations and requirements for the Whole-Ship are embodied within the integrated Marine Systems design.
- Lead the systems safety assessment of the integrated Marine design.
- Lead the identification of Marine design integration issues.
- Lead on resolution of Marine technical integration issues.
- Ensuring effective definition and configuration control of the Marine System design.
- Support development of the Marine Systems Safety Case; incorporate Key Hazard assessment work completed as part of the systems safety analysis.
- Act as point of contact for the Marine System Approval Authority with respect to modelling and systems safety.
- Act as the delegated Control Account Manager for own area of work; lead on the development of project plans, project delivery and reporting and project risk management.
- Inspire the team and wider stakeholders in delivery of the project vision.
- Support the Type 26 Systems Integration Authority in their role as delegated engineering authority for the Type 26 Global Combat Ship design.
Key Technical Skills:
- Manages specialist multi-discipline, multi-site teams interfacing with a wide range of stakeholders.
- Ability to work closely with other domains to develop the overall integrated ship design
- Strong understanding of key systems engineering principles and the MoD's approach to integration.
- Comprehensive knowledge of complex system modelling using SysML.
- Good knowledge of the development of systems safety analysis and the development of system safety cases.
- Ability to identify and resolve key engineering issues including cost capability trade-offs within the specialism.
- Experience of MoD / Customer management and a collaborative working environment.
- Excellent project management and supplier management skills.
- Knowledge of warship design processes and inter-relationships would be advantageous.
Matchtech acts as an employment agency for permanent recruitment and employment business for the supply of temporary workers and is part of Gattaca Plc.
Gattaca Plc provides support services to Matchtech and may assist with processing your application.
You can not apply for this job as its status is Closed.